On January 12, Secretary of the Hanoi Party Committee Dinh Tien Dung chaired a meeting with citizens and resolved two cases in Soc Son and Thanh Oai districts.
Secretary of the City Party Committee Dinh Tien Dung received citizens to resolve petitions.
This is the implementation of Regulation No. 11-QD/TU, dated February 18, 2019 of the Politburo on the responsibility of heads of Party committees at all levels in receiving people, having direct dialogue with people and handling people's reflections and recommendations.
The first case is that of Mr. Nguyen Van Nhat, born in 1963, in Nam Ly village, Bac Son commune, Soc Son district. Mr. Nhat requested to resolve the issue of the Bac Son commune People's Committee losing the land use right certificate that had been issued to his family since 1998.
Previously, Mr. Nhat had requested the People's Committee of Bac Son commune and the People's Committee of Soc Son district many times (over 20 years) to reissue the land use right certificate for his family but it was not resolved.
Concluding this incident, Secretary of the City Party Committee Dinh Tien Dung said that the Chairman of the People's Committee of Soc Son district, on behalf of the local government, accepted responsibility for the loss of Mr. Nhat's documents, and on that basis requested the district and commune to deeply review this matter.
Mr. Dinh Tien Dung requested the Chairman of the People's Committee of Soc Son district to direct departments and offices to coordinate with the commune to re-establish the records and issue "red books" to Mr. Nhat's family according to current legal regulations before the Lunar New Year of Giap Thin 2024. The Secretary of the City Party Committee assigned the Party Committee of the City People's Committee to direct the City Inspectorate to supervise the implementation of the above request.
Agreeing with the conclusion of the City Party Secretary, Mr. Nguyen Van Nhat thanked the attention, close attention and direction to resolve the issue appropriately.
The second case is that of Mr. Nguyen Huu Quynh (a war invalid, born in 1966, in Tan Uoc commune, Thanh Oai district). According to the petition, in 2003, Mr. Quynh was sold a plot of land by the People's Committee of Tan Uoc commune at Thuong gate, Tri Le village, Tan Uoc commune. He paid the money to the People's Committee and filled the ground. In 2009, the People's Committee took this land to build a village cultural house, but has not yet returned the land to him.
After listening to the report and proposed solutions from the authorities and Thanh Oai district government, Secretary of the City Party Committee Dinh Tien Dung assigned the Party Committee of the City People's Committee to direct the Department of Natural Resources and Environment to guide the Thanh Oai district People's Committee on the legal basis for allocating land to Mr. Quynh's family.
Based on the agreement between the local government and the family on the 151.2m2 plot of land, Mr. Dinh Tien Dung requested that Thanh Oai District Party Committee urgently direct the allocation of land to the family according to regulations, striving to complete before the Lunar New Year of Giap Thin 2024. Because the land allocation limit according to regulations is only 120m2, the Secretary of the City Party Committee requested the family to pay the excess land in the allocated land according to regulations. For the money the family previously paid to the Commune People's Committee, the local government must pay the interest to the family according to regulations.
At the same time, the City Party Secretary requested the Thanh Oai district government to review mechanisms and policies to provide the highest level of support for the family.
The representative of Mr. Nguyen Huu Quynh's family agreed with the solution according to the conclusion of the City Party Secretary and thanked him for his timely and correct attention and direction.
